Product Name st-Ht31
Description

st-Ht31 is a stearated and cell permeable version of the peptide Ht-31, which inhibits the interaction between the RII subunits of cAMP-dependent PKA and A-kinase anchoring protein (AKAP).   The sequence of st-Ht31 is derived from human thyroid RII anchoring protein Ht31, comprising residues 493-515, and is the minimum region of Ht 31 required for RII binding.   Disruption of the AKAP-PKA interaction by st-Ht31 alters human airway smooth muscle  proliferation and enhances contractile force generation with upregulation of the contractile protein α-sm-actin.   st-Ht31 also increases cytosolic PKA activity and is able to reverse foam cell formation and restore metabolic health in otherwise dysfunctional macrophages.


Synonyms S-Ht31, st-Ht 31 (493-515)
Molecular Weight 2798.27 Da
Target Protein-protein interactions,Kinases
Amino Acid Sequence Stearyl-DLIEEAASRIVDAVIEQVKAAGAY
Form Freeze dried solid
Purity >95% by hplc
Cas Number 188425-80-1
Storage Store dry, frozen and in the dark
Notes Modifications: N-terminal stearyl
